Name Day: Dates by Country

Rune's name day is celebrated on June 2 in Norway and November 24 in Sweden.

Name origin and meaning

The name Rune stems from the ancient Germanic word for 'secret' or 'mystery', directly linked to the runic alphabets used by Germanic peoples. These alphabets weren't merely writing systems but held spiritual and magical significance, used for divination and inscription. The name’s association with these powerful symbols imbued it with a sense of wisdom and hidden knowledge. Historically, the name wasn’t a common given name but rather a descriptor relating to those skilled in runic lore. Over time, it evolved into a given name, particularly in Scandinavian regions, retaining its connection to a rich cultural past.


Name Identity: Gender Classification

Rune is predominantly a masculine name across most of the world, particularly in Scandinavia and English-speaking countries. In Norway and Sweden, it’s almost exclusively given to boys. However, there's a growing, though still limited, trend of using Rune as a unisex name, especially in more modern naming practices. This is often driven by the name’s strong, yet somewhat ethereal sound. While rare, it has been used for girls, particularly in artistic or alternative communities. The perception remains overwhelmingly male, though.
